HIL Calibration Cards

While all HIL devices are factory-calibrated, over time, due to component aging and drift, the HIL I/O stage may exhibit some small gain and offset errors. The HIL4 Calibration Card and HIL6 Calibration Card are designed to help remove these errors via a single-click calibration routine.

Maintaining Accuracy with One-Click Calibration

Hardware-in-the-loop systems are factory-calibrated to deliver precise and reliable results from day one. Over time, small variations in analog and digital I/O can naturally emerge. Using a simple, repeatable calibration process helps maintain measurement integrity and ensures continued confidence in test results.

When plugged into your HIL, the Calibration Card automatically measures gain and offset errors across all analog input and output channels. Analog inputs are verified using the card’s precision voltage references, followed by validation of analog outputs through the analog input paths. The entire process runs with a single click, restoring I/O performance to factory-level accuracy and confirming that your HIL system is operating as intended.

HIL4 Calibration Card

The HIL4 Calibration Card is designed for HIL101 and all HIL4-series simulators, enabling one-click testing and calibration of analog, digital, and power supply I/O. It plugs directly into the HIL device and uses precision onboard voltage references to ensure accurate, repeatable calibration results.

HIL6 Calibration Card

The HIL6 Calibration Card supports all HIL5- and HIL6-series simulators and offers the same one-click test and calibration workflow for full I/O verification and calibration. Direct DIN41612 connectivity and integrated status indicators make it easy to validate system health and maintain long-term measurement accuracy.
